Abstract
To our knowledge we report the first case of bladder perforation in a patient with no history of pelvic surgery or delivery. The patient presented 3 days post partum with renal failure and ascites. Paracentesis and cystography confirmed urinary ascites and bladder rupture. After open bladder repair convalescence was uneventful. The literature on intraperitoneal bladder rupture and urinary ascites is reviewed.Entities:
